Willene Yvonne Davis was born September 21, 1954, in Mound City, IL to Louis and Elizabeth Davis.
As a young child, Willene and her parents relocated to Mount Vernon, IL. There she received her elementary and intermediate education. Willene graduated from Mount Vernon High School in 1972. She furthered her education at Rend Lake College of Nursing where she received a nursing license. She worked for many years at Good Samaritan Hospital in Mount Vernon, IL.
Willene later moved to Peoria, IL where she continued her nursing career serving with excellence and care.
Lastly, she made her home in Indianapolis, IN where she held several jobs before retiring in1998.
Willene loved to read all kind of books, play cards, listen to music, dance, play bingo win the game and scream her favorite phrase “Pay The Lady!” A cold slice of watermelon was never out of the question. Willene was blessed with four beautiful children that she showered with love and kindness. One of her greatest joys was spending time with her grandchildren who affectionately called her “Grandma” and filled her heart with pride and laughter.
Willene made the most important decision that one can ever make; she professed her hope in Christ and accepted His saving grace.
Willene Yvonne Davis answered her call to rest on Wednesday, July 9, 2025 surrounded by the love of her family as she crossed over into eternal peace. Her father, Louis Davis and sister, Joyce Davis preceded her in death.
Willene leaves a legacy of love and faith to those who love her: children: Adrian Davis, Shanrika Wattley (Raymond), Laron Davis (Aisha) and Terry Faint (Ashley); mother, Elizabeth Davis; siblings: Louis Davis, Marvin Davis, Ronald Davis, Sheryl Davis, Brenda Davis, Dora Davis, Janice Howell (Darry) and Terra Davis (Anthony); fifteen grandchildren and twelve great-grandchildren; as well as a host of nieces, nephews, cousins and friends.
